{UAH} WHEN THE BIG & MIGHTY START LOOKING DOWN AT THE GRASS OF THE WORLD!
On 13th April 2017, barely three months after Trump took office, one of the first things he did was to drop "The Mother Of All Bombs" on a tiny remote village called Narghahar in Afghanistan. A village that arguably paused no threat to America or it's citizens thousands of kilometers away, but received the most destructive conventional bomb in existence today, just out of the blue, shredding to pieces any of the rural families, and their farm animals.
Four years later, Joe Biden takes office and does almost the exact same thing, starting his presidency by bombing Syria, seemingly also out of the blue, while claiming climate change, Corvid-19, US economic recovery and global cooperation repair to be his most urgent priorities.
Allow me to note that he had also just complained about Saudi Arabia's military action in Yemen, then immediately turned around and did the exact same thing against the people of Syria.
The pattern of bullying emerging here could be that every new US president is nudged, possibly by Pentagon/Department of Defense generals, to start their term of office in this brutal sledgehammer fashion. Possibly a way to enable the new entrant simply obtain their militarism credentials in global politics, and maybe a deterring act with an unwritten message that America is prepared to take lethal action against whoever on this planet doesn't tow the line. To the US defense industry, it might be a way to ensure that all new US leaders get blood on their hands immediately upon starting their term, and then do not feel any discomfort in taking more heavier military action during the rest of their presidency after getting the proverbial "taste for blood" so to speak.
Such acts also have an immediate impact on the stocks of companies that are part of the famous American Military Industrial Complex. Giving their defense industry some much needed stability as US defense companies shares rise whenever there is conflict. So starting a new presidency with an act of war has a long term reassuring effect to the US defense industry in general.
Ladies & Gentlemen,
The right to life is sacred. Even indeginous people's, their poor children, their empoverished families and their meagre wealth in remote countries. Also, the sovereignty of people's around the world must not be maligned by powerful nations who are increasingly showing little regard for global consensus and international law in regards to war and aerial bombardments in certain types of profiled countries. Therefore there is much need today for the leaders of those mighty nations to exercise restraint, respect for the weak, and not summarily bully, murder, or impose their will on those around the world who did not get to elect them.
